TechDays 2011 NAO Programming Session Jérôme Monceaux Chris Kilner.
Lists and the Collection Interface Chapter 4. Chapter Objectives To become familiar with the List interface To understand how to write an array-based.
Data Structures Chapter 12. Chapter Contents Chapter Objectives 12.1 Introductory Example: Counting Internet Addresses 12.2 The ArrayList and LinkedList.
COMP 121 Week 9: AbstractList and ArrayList. Objectives List common operations and properties of Lists as distinct from Collections Extend the AbstractCollection.
Topic 33 ArrayList. 2 Exercise Write a program that reads a file and displays the words of that file as a list. –First display all words. –Then display.
Building Java Programs Chapter 10 ArrayList. 2 Exercise Write a program that reads a file and displays the words of that file as a list. –First display.
CS203 LECTURE 4 John Hurley Cal State LA. Memorize This! A data structure is a systematic way to organize information in order to improve the efficiency.
Two Dimensional Arrays and ArrayList. Declaring a two-dimensional array requires two sets of brackets and two size declarators – The first one is for.
2013.03.06. ArrayList Difference of Array and ArrayList [Sample code] TestArrayList.java.
Lecture 2 coding_principles
CS 122 – Jan. 9 The nature of computer science General solutions are better What is a program? OO programming Broad outline of topics: – Program design,
Copyright © 2014 by John Wiley & Sons. All rights reserved.1 Chapter 18 – Generic Classes.